PRESERVING JARS | KITCHENWARE | KITCHEN WAREHOUSE™
Preserving jars, explained. Preserving jars are essentially glass jars with a wide mouth or regular mouth and tight-fitting lid. Jar lids are typically made of either stainless steel with a twist top design or of glass with a clip top fastening and silicone seal.

HOW TO STERILISE JARS | BBC GOOD FOOD
Fill the jars with the preserve, screw on the lid then wrap each one up in newspaper. Pop the wrapped jars in a large saucepan, cover with water then bring to a simmer, then simmer for 20 mins. Turn the heat off then leave the jars to cool completely in the pan.

BEGINNER'S GUIDE TO FERMENTED FOODS | BBC GOOD FOOD
Wash the jars and lids thoroughly in warm soapy water, then leave to dry on the draining rack, drying the lids with a clean tea towel. Put your jars on a shelf in the oven for 15 mins, then remove with oven gloves. Once cool, they are ready to use. Try your hand at fermenting your own food at home with these easy to follow recipes…

HOW TO USE A FERMENTING CROCK • THE PRAIRIE HOMESTEAD
Dec 22, 2021 · The downside to using fermenting crocks, instead of simple mason jars, is that they are usually too big and heavy to stick in your fridge. I usually scoop the fermented food out of the crock and into mason jars to store in the fridge.

LE PARFAIT SUPER JARS - LE PARFAIT
Le Parfait Super Jars are perfect for preserving fresh fruits and vegetables. Cooks recognize its wire hinge and iconic orange rubber seal. Top tip: only use the rubber seal once and to change it after each use.
